Immerse yourself in the heart of Jermuk's healing tradition at the Mineral Water Gallery. This iconic structure houses a collection of natural mineral water springs, each with its unique temperature and mineral composition. Visitors can sample these therapeutic waters, believed to possess various health benefits, and learn about the history and significance of Jermuk as a renowned spa town. Jermuk's history as a health resort dates back centuries, with evidence of mineral water usage found in ancient ruins. However, it was in the 20th century that Jermuk truly flourished as a prominent spa destination. The Mineral Water Gallery was constructed to provide a central location for visitors to access and sample the various mineral water springs, solidifying Jermuk's reputation as a premier health retreat. At the Mineral Water Gallery, you can sample the different mineral water springs, each marked with its unique properties and recommended uses. Many believe the waters aid in digestion, liver function, and overall well-being. The gallery itself is a beautiful architectural structure, providing a pleasant environment for relaxation and contemplation. Outside the gallery, you can explore the surrounding park, enjoy the fresh mountain air, and take in the stunning views of the Arpa River gorge.

Transportation

Reaching Jermuk generally involves traveling from Yerevan, the capital of Armenia. You can hire a taxi or take a marshrutka (minibus) from Yerevan's main bus station to Jermuk. The journey takes approximately 3-4 hours. Once in Jermuk, the Mineral Water Gallery is centrally located and easily accessible on foot.
